The 7 day weather forecast summary for Huludao Gang, Switzerland, Global Ports:

Taking a look at the forecast over the coming week and the average daytime maximum will be around 20°C, with a high of 22°C expected on Friday morning. The average minimum temperature for the week ahead will be around 14°C, dipping to its lowest on Sunday morning at 11°C. Wednesday is expected to see the most precipitation with around 18mm, or about 0.7inches anticipated. The strongest wind will be felt on Sunday morning, coming from the northeast, and reaching around 26mph, that's about 43km/h.
